Learning about Sports Betting Sites Not on GamStop
GamStop is a United Kingdom-based self-exclusion program that allows individuals to voluntarily restrict their use of gambling websites licensed by the UK Gambling Commission. When players register with GamStop, they’re automatically blocked from all participating platforms for a chosen period. However, betting platforms licensed through international licenses from jurisdictions like Malta, Curacao, or Gibraltar aren’t required to participate in this scheme, providing other choices for bettors.
These alternative betting platforms typically hold licenses from established international regulatory authorities and function legally within their jurisdictions. They offer UK players access to betting opportunities without GamStop restrictions, though they lack UKGC oversight. Comprehending the regulatory structure of these sites is essential, as established international operators preserve high standards through their licensing authorities, implementing their own gambling protection measures and bettor protection protocols.
The main distinction lies in regulatory oversight rather than legitimacy. While UKGC-licensed sites must adhere to specific UK regulations including GamStop participation, internationally regulated platforms adhere to their respective jurisdiction’s rules. This doesn’t inherently make them less safe, but it does demand bettors to demonstrate greater due diligence when selecting a platform. Evaluating licensing qualifications, security protocols, and reputation becomes essential when choosing where to place your bets.

Safe Wagering on Non-GamStop Platforms
While platforms operating beyond the GamStop framework offer greater flexibility, maintaining responsible gambling habits remains paramount for your overall wellbeing and mental health. These sites typically provide various tools and features designed to help you stay in control, though the responsibility ultimately rests with individual punters to use them effectively and recognize when gambling becomes problematic rather than casual enjoyment.
Self-Control Methods for Bettors
Setting up individual boundaries before you start wagering is crucial for maintaining control over your betting habits. Set strict budgets for daily, weekly, and monthly contributions and adhere to them regardless of wins or losses. Monitor your betting history on a regular basis to spot trends that might suggest problematic behavior, such as chasing losses or increasing stake sizes above your set limits.
Time management is just as crucial as responsible budgeting when engaging in online betting. Allocate particular hours for placing wagers rather than letting it take over your spare time unpredictably. Pause frequently during sessions, refrain from wagering when stressed or intoxicated, and never use wagering to escape from life difficulties or anxiety.
Alternative Protective Options Offered
Many offshore platforms provide deposit limits, loss limits, and time session alerts that function similarly to UK-regulated sites. Make use of these tools proactively by setting them at levels you’re comfortable with before starting to bet. Some operators also provide reality checks that show time and money spent at regular intervals during your gaming sessions.
Think about using third-party software like Gamban or BetBlocker if you need additional support in restricting entry to gambling websites. These applications work across multiple devices and can block thousands of gambling sites. Additionally, maintain open communication with trusted friends or family members about your gambling habits, and get professional support from services such as GamCare or Gambling Therapy if you observe indicators of problem gambling emerging.
